Description

5-(4,4,5,5-Tetramethyl-1,3,2-Dioxaborolan-2-Yl)-3-(Trifluoromethoxy)Pyridin-2-Amine (Wx192479) is a high-purity boronic ester derivative, a critical building block in modern synthetic chemistry. This compound is valued for its role in facilitating key carbon-carbon bond-forming reactions, enabling the efficient synthesis of complex molecular architectures. It is primarily sought by researchers and process chemists in the pharmaceutical, agrochemical, and advanced materials industries for drug discovery and development programs.

Application

  • Pharmaceutical Intermediate: A key precursor in Suzuki-Miyaura cross-coupling reactions for synthesizing novel active pharmaceutical ingredients (APIs), particularly in kinase inhibitor and CNS drug research.
  • Agrochemical Synthesis: Used in the development of new herbicides, fungicides, and insecticides that require the incorporation of the trifluoromethoxy-pyridine motif.
  • Material Science Research: Serves as a building block for creating organic electronic materials, such as ligands for OLEDs and other functional polymers.
  • Chemical Biology & Proteomics: Employed in the synthesis of molecular probes and bioconjugation reagents for target identification and validation studies.

Basic Information

Product Name 5-(4,4,5,5-Tetramethyl-1,3,2-Dioxaborolan-2-Yl)-3-(Trifluoromethoxy)Pyridin-2-Amine (Wx192479)
CAS No. 1620575-08-7
Molecular Formula C12H16BF3N2O3
Molecular Weight 304.08 g/mol
Synonyms 2-Amino-5-(4,4,5,5-tetramethyl-1,3,2-dioxaborolan-2-yl)-3-(trifluoromethoxy)pyridine; 3-(Trifluoromethoxy)-5-(4,4,5,5-tetramethyl-1,3,2-dioxaborolan-2-yl)pyridin-2-amine; WX-192479; 1620575-08-7; 5-(Tetramethyl-1,3,2-dioxaborolan-2-yl)-3-(trifluoromethoxy)pyridin-2-amine; Pinacol ester of [2-Amino-3-(trifluoromethoxy)pyridin-5-yl]boronic acid.

Storage

Preserve in a tightly closed container, protected from light. Store under an inert atmosphere (e.g., nitrogen or argon) at 2-8°C in a dry, cool, and well-ventilated place. Due to its hygroscopic and easily oxidized nature, prolonged exposure to air, moisture, or ambient light should be avoided. Allow the sealed container to reach room temperature before opening to prevent moisture condensation.
